The Stem Izon 2.0 is the WiFi camera you should consider. Number one, it’s cheaper. Number two, it’s a lot cheaper. These two cameras will cost you about one-ninth of what a pair of Nest Cams would cost. The price tags are so far apart, it’s almost like the Stem Izon isn’t even the same kind of product.

Except that it performs the same basic functions: live video streaming over WiFi to an Android or iOS app, with motion detection, sound detection, alerts, and a certain amount of recording.

Is it anywhere near as good? Eh, probably not. Will you ever notice the difference? Hard to say. If you want to go beyond the rudiments, maybe.
